Mother and daughters struck by vehicle in Mamaroneck crosswalk
A mother and her two children were struck by a vehicle Saturday morning at an intersection in Mamaroneck.
Police received a notification of pedestrians struck just after 10 a.m. at Mamaroneck Avenue and Prospect Avenue.
Officers responded and found a 44-year-old Mamaroneck resident and her two daughters, ages 5 and 2, at the scene. Police say the driver was a 44-year-old Larchmont man who remained at the scene and is cooperating with police.
The initial investigation shows that the pedestrians had the crosswalk signal and the driver had a green light, but the driver failed to yield to the pedestrians in a crosswalk.
The driver was issued a summons for failing to yield to a pedestrian in a crosswalk.
The pedestrians were taken to Westchester Medical Center. No serious injuries were reported.
